Job Description:
A 1st Class Boiler Operator is responsible for safely and efficiently operating, monitoring, and maintaining high-pressure boilers and related equipment. Key duties include monitoring and adjusting water, fuel, and chemical levels; observing gauges and meters; performing routine inspections and maintenance; troubleshooting issues; and maintaining detailed logs of all activities. They are also responsible for ensuring the equipment operates within safety regulations and company policies.
Core responsibilities
-
Boiler operation:Operate and control boilers to supply steam or heat for various industrial processes. This includes adjusting valves to control water, fuel, and air flow to maintain specified pressure and temperature.
-
Monitoring and control:Continuously monitor gauges, meters, and charts to ensure the boilers are operating correctly and efficiently. Adjust settings as needed based on readings.
-
Water treatment:Test boiler water quality and add necessary chemicals to prevent corrosion and deposits. Monitor and maintain required water levels.
-
Maintenance and inspection:Perform regular inspections of boilers and auxiliary equipment like pumps and compressors. Conduct routine maintenance tasks, lubricate equipment, and address minor issues to prevent malfunctions.
-
Safety and compliance:Ensure all operations comply with safety regulations and company policies. Conduct safety checks on critical components and take immediate action if an issue is detected.
-
Record-keeping:Maintain daily logs of boiler operations, including instrument readings, test results, maintenance activities, and any equipment malfunctions or repairs.
-
Housekeeping:Maintain a clean and orderly workspace around the boiler and associated equipment.
